Welcome to the Auto Authority LLC automotive blog. Today, let's talk about the effect of tire wear. Let's focus on stopping in wet Oshkosh conditions. In order for a tire to have good contact with the road, it has to move the water out of the way. If it can't move the water, the tire will actually ride on top of a thin film of water. So how does a tire move water? It has channels for water to flow through. Look at your vehicle tire and you'll see channels: channels that run around the tire and channels that flow across the tire. They're designed to direct water away from the tire so it can contact the road better. Just insert a quarter into the tread. Put it in upside down. If the tread doesn't cover George Washington's hairline, it's time to replace your vehicle tires. With a Canadian quarter, the tread should cover the numbers in the year stamp. Many Oshkosh residents have heard of this technique using a penny and Abe Lincoln's head - the old method. That measure gives you 2/32 of an inch – half the suggested amount. Of course, vehicle tires are a major purchase. Most of us in Oshkosh want to get as many miles out of them as we can. But there's a real safety trade-off. It's your choice. Auto Authority LLC Tracking True in Wisconsin: Wheel Alignment in OshkoshPosted October 11, 2012 12:00 PMThe biggest issue for Oshkosh area drivers is always safety. When your vehicle wheels are out of alignment, the vehicle will pull to one side, which could lead to an accident. When you're vehicle is out of alignment, you should have it taken care of right away at Auto Authority LLC in Oshkosh. When undergoing an alignment service at Auto Authority LLC, your vehicle is put on an alignment rack where the tires, steering and suspension parts are checked for damage. Then the alignment is charted and checked against the factory settings. Obviously, a big jolt can seriously knock things out of alignment, but Oshkosh area drivers also need to understand that a series of smaller ones can add up. That's why we recommend periodic alignment checks. If your vehicle owner's manual doesn't specify the interval, once a year might be appropriate.
